On my '04 Vert, the ORIGINAL front driver's/passengers original floor mats have no ID tag, logo or brand name. They have a part number PP1-7H32-L-1. What you are displaying some appears to be aftermarket.

Performance Choice floor mats are from Mid-Amercia Motorsports. Not sure who the supplier for OEM is but I doubt it is Mid-America.

Those sure look like aftermarket floor mats. Factory GM originals did not have the crossflags stitched into them. The shape is different also compared to the originals.
